Revenue Analyst
The interview process involved one interview and two online aptitude tests. These tests had 18 questions to be completed in 6 minutes, and they were tough, designed to test stress endurance and thinking speed. It's recommended to practice online aptitude tests beforehand. There were no further interviews after this.

Revenue Analyst
First, there was an online assessment with numerical and verbal reasoning questions, plus four recorded behavioural interview questions. The online assessment was quite difficult, I couldn't finish either part. It's a good idea to research the role and find practice tests for the cute-e assessments. Then, there was a face-to-face assessment and interview. The assessment included an Excel task using basic functions and a network revenue maximising problem which was discussed in the interview. They asked standard questions during the interview and didn't delve too deep into my past experience. Again, do some research on the role and make sure you understand the job description.

Revenue Analyst
The interview process started with an online test. A week later, there was a video interview. About two weeks after that, I had an on-site test and interview with HR and directors. The whole process took about a month to get the results, but the interviewers were very nice and helpful.
